如何在服务器端绑定域名,服务器如何绑定域名与设置访问权限
- 综合资讯
- 2025-03-14 02:44:35
- 2

在服务器端绑定域名通常涉及几个关键步骤:首先需要注册一个域名并获取其DNS记录;然后配置服务器的网络设置以解析该域名;最后通过Web服务器软件(如Apache或Ngin...
在服务器端绑定域名通常涉及几个关键步骤:首先需要注册一个域名并获取其DNS记录;然后配置服务器的网络设置以解析该域名;最后通过Web服务器软件(如Apache或Nginx)来处理域名的请求,对于设置访问权限,可以通过修改Web服务器的配置文件来实现,例如限制某些IP地址或者特定用户的访问。,如果您使用的是Linux系统上的Apache服务器,您可以编辑/etc/apache2/sites-available/default.conf
文件来添加新的虚拟主机配置,在此文件中,您可以为您的域名创建一个新的站点块,指定文档根目录和索引页面等详细信息,还可以通过.htaccess
文件或在Apache的httpd.conf
主配置文件中来进一步定制安全策略,比如启用防盗链、限制下载速度以及实施IP白名单或黑名单等功能。,正确地配置服务器端的域名绑定和访问控制对于保护网站的安全性和稳定性至关重要。
在当今互联网时代,拥有自己的网站或应用程序是企业和个人展示自我、推广业务的重要方式之一,为了实现这一目标,服务器端的域名绑定和访问权限设置至关重要,本文将详细探讨如何在服务器端成功绑定域名以及如何设置合适的访问权限,以确保网站的稳定和安全运行。
域名绑定概述
-
域名的定义与重要性
域名(Domain Name)是指互联网上用于标识计算机和网络服务的地址,它由一串字符组成,通常分为两部分:主机名和顶级域名(如.com、.org等),域名的重要性在于其易于记忆和使用,同时也能提升品牌形象和信任度。
-
DNS解析过程
图片来源于网络,如有侵权联系删除
当我们在浏览器中输入一个域名时,实际上是在请求将该域名转换为对应的IP地址,这个过程称为DNS解析(Domain Name System Resolution),通过DNS服务器完成,一旦获得正确的IP地址后,浏览器就可以直接与目标服务器进行通信了。
-
购买和管理域名
购买域名需要选择一家可靠的注册商,例如GoDaddy、Namecheap等,在选择时要考虑价格、支持的语言和服务质量等因素,还需要定期续费和维护域名记录以保证其有效性。
-
配置域名指向服务器
- 在购买了域名之后,我们需要将其指向我们的服务器,这可以通过修改DNS记录来实现,具体步骤如下:
- 登录到您的域名控制面板;
- 找到“DNS管理”或类似的选项卡;
- 添加新的A记录或CNAME记录来指定目标服务器的IP地址或子域名;
- 确认更改并等待一段时间让新配置生效。
- 在购买了域名之后,我们需要将其指向我们的服务器,这可以通过修改DNS记录来实现,具体步骤如下:
服务器端绑定域名的方法
-
使用Nginx作为Web服务器
-
Nginx是一款高性能的开源HTTP服务器软件,适用于静态内容和动态内容的服务,要绑定域名并在Nginx中启用SSL证书以保护数据传输安全,可以按照以下步骤操作:
-
安装Nginx和其他相关工具(如OpenSSL);
-
创建一个新的站点配置文件,比如
/etc/nginx/sites-available/mydomain.com
; -
在该文件中添加以下基本配置项:
server { listen 80; server_name mydomain.com www.mydomain.com; location / { root /var/www/html; index index.html index.htm; } # SSL部分省略... }
-
使新配置文件生效:
ln -s /etc/nginx/sites-available/mydomain.com /etc/nginx/sites-enabled/
-
启动或重启Nginx服务:
systemctl restart nginx
-
-
-
使用Apache作为Web服务器
图片来源于网络,如有侵权联系删除
- Apache也是一款广泛使用的开源HTTP服务器,同样支持多种编程语言的扩展模块,若您打算使用Apache来托管网站,则需遵循类似流程但注意某些细节差异:
- 安装Apache和相关开发包;
- 编辑虚拟主机配置文件(通常是
/etc/httpd/conf.d/vhosts.conf
),添加新的虚拟主机条目; - 配置SSL证书(如果需要的话);
- 重启Apache服务以应用更改。
- Apache也是一款广泛使用的开源HTTP服务器,同样支持多种编程语言的扩展模块,若您打算使用Apache来托管网站,则需遵循类似流程但注意某些细节差异:
设置访问权限
-
理解Linux文件系统权限
Linux操作系统采用传统的九级权限模式来控制文件的读写执行权,每个文件都有三个主要所有者:属主、组和其他人,它们分别对应不同的权限级别。
-
调整目录和文件的权限
-
为了确保安全性,我们应该合理地分配文件和目录的权限,对于公共可读但不允许写入的文件夹,我们可以设置为755;而对于只有特定用户才能访问的资源,则应设置为700,具体的命令如下所示:
chmod 755 /path/to/directory
或者:
chmod 700 /path/to/file
-
-
利用SELinux增强安全性
SELinux(Security-Enhanced Linux)是一种先进的网络安全技术,它可以进一步限制进程对文件系统的访问权限,如果您开启了SELinux并且希望某个程序能够读取特定的文件,那么就需要为这个程序授予相应的权限,这可以通过编辑相关的政策文件来完成。
-
监控日志并及时响应异常行为
日志记录可以帮助我们追踪和分析潜在的安全威胁,建议定期检查系统日志,特别是那些与网络流量有关的记录,一旦发现可疑活动,立即采取措施加以防范和处理。
要想成功地在服务器端绑定域名并进行有效的安全管理,不仅需要对各种技术和概念有深入的了解,还要具备一定的实践经验和应变能力,才能构建出一个既高效又安全的网络环境,从而更好地服务于广大
本文链接:https://zhitaoyun.cn/1789988.html
发表评论